Registered Nurse RN Emergency Room Brookside FSED
On-site · Kansas, United States
Job Summary
Coordinate and deliver high-quality, patient-centered care in the Emergency Room in collaboration with medical providers and the care team. Provide individualized, comprehensive care using established nursing models (Assess, Perform, Teach, and Manage); advocate for patients and families; assess and manage pain; perform procedures and document care; educate patients and families about conditions, treatment plans, medications, and follow-up measures; teach on follow-up lifestyle and health maintenance. Requires internal certifications such as ACLS, BCLS, PALS/TNCC or equivalent within specified timelines and a nursing diploma with RN licensure. Commitment to safe, high-quality care and continuous improvement within a hospital setting.
Required Qualifications
- RN license/registered nurse
- Registered Nurse Diploma
-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S) within 6 months of start date
- Basic Cardiac Life Support (BCLS) within 30 days of start date
- Emergency Nurse Pediatric Course, or PALS Pediatric Advanced Life Support within 1 year of start date
- Advanced Trauma Care for Nurses, or Trauma Nursing Core Course within 1 year of start date
- No Travel Required
- No experience Required
